Is Nvidia Overvalued? Examining the Price-to-Earnings Ratio

Nvidia's meteoric rise in recent years has propelled its stock price to unprecedented heights. With a current price-to-earnings ratio (P/E) exceeding thirty, investors are scrutinizing whether Nvidia is undervalued. A high P/E ratio often suggests that a company's stock price is relatively expensive compared to its earnings.

However, experts argue that Nvidia's dominance in the semiconductor market, coupled with its consistent growth trajectory, supports a premium valuation. Nvidia's {strategic{ acquisitions and partnerships are also contributing to its expansion.
